CRAVEN COUNTY, N.C. (WITN) - The Craven County Sheriff’s Office is looking for information related to a person reported missing 25 years ago.
The sheriff’s office says 16-year-old Christina Lewis was reported missing on June 20th, 2000, from Half Moon Road.
Deputies say her family last heard from her on June 6th, 2000, but waited to file a report because Lewis had previously left home and returned after a few days.
Investigators say they conducted many interviews at the time of her disappearance and in the years since the report.
Many properties and waterways were searched based on information from the interviews.
